Tea Cup Pin Cushion

Supply List:

(1) Lovely Tea Cup & Saucer

(1) 3″ Styrofoam ball

12″ square of matching fabric

12″ square of thin batting

1/2 yard of wired ribbon

1/2 yard of braid or fringe trim

(1) 3-4″ tassel

Hot glue gun & glue

Rubber band

Step 1:

Place your fabric wrong side up on a flat surface and layer the batting in the center.  Place the Styrofoam ball in the center and gather up the loose edges into a tail, smoothing out any large pleats.  Wrap the tail with the rubber band and trim to 2 inches.

Step 2:

Run a line of hot glue around the edge of the teacup about 1/2″ below the edge.  Position the fabric wrapped ball in the center of the teacup and press firmly.   Next, glue the braid to the edge of the tea cup so that it fills the gap between the teacup and the fabric ball. Use pins to temporarily hold the braid in place as you glue & trim the excess braid for a snug fit.  Gently remove one pin at a time.

Step 3:

Gather up one edge of the wire ribbon to fit snugly between the bottom of the teacup and the saucer.  Again, glue in place.  Add the tassel to the handle of the teacup and you’re done!

I usually place a few color coordinated pins on top and sometimes

a piece of lace or silk flower.  Enjoy!
